Defra - The future of the waterways 
A wide ranging consultation for all those interested in all aspects of our waterways (canals). 
Closes March 25th

 

Next Generation Broadband. How the Government intends to spend the 50p a month charge on fixed line telephones to improve broadband
Very important for rural to ensure a proper service. Response date 1st April

 

Pesticide EU Sustainable Use
Very wide ranging consultation includes bystanders and information to rural residents.
Closes April 5th

 

Grant funding structures for renewable heat incentives
Closes April 26th.  Yorkshire and Humberside Workshop on Renewable Heat Incentive, Bradford City Hall on March 15th.

 

Primary Health Care for Socially Excluded Groups     
No timescale but comments needed soonest.  Rural tends to be individuals but I wonder if a village is an excluded group if the elderly can not access.
